Output 94e148d88fc4414988c42648fff13cd0602555d21a33e1921e8e09c5aedfd4b8:43

value
197343126
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2155a5e6837eac37a486bd7539f43127263160eb OP_EQUAL
address
34jGpodwfdeVxgwGa278g9J6nSR32jpW6p
transaction
94e148d88fc4414988c42648fff13cd0602555d21a33e1921e8e09c5aedfd4b8
confirmations
232191
spent
true